![]() We are using FILTER() function to filter down the talent table to all candidates who have given performance (E8) and potential (D5) values The above formula assumes E$8 has the performance rating value and $D5 has potential. In the top left cell, use the below formula. Note: this method requires Excel 365 with dynamic array functions. ![]() ![]() If you have Excel 365 and access to dynamic array functions like FILTER(), you can use formulas to generate the 3×3 talent map grid.Įlse, you can use Pivot Tables to generate the talent map grid. Step 2: Create the talent map 9 box grid visual Feel free to add things like department or team names. At the very least, you want staff name, performance and potential. In a blank spreadsheet, gather the data about your staff. Step 1: Gather data about performance and potential of your staff
